Agent Compromises in Distributed Problem Solving

نویسندگان

  • Yi Tang
  • Jiming Liu
  • Xiaolong Jin
چکیده

ERA is a multi-agent oriented method for solving constraint satisfaction problems [5]. In this method, agents make decisions based on the information obtained from their environments in the process of solving a problem. Each agent has three basic behaviors: least-move, better-move, and random-move. The random-move is the unique behavior that may help the multi-agent system escape from a local minimum. Although random-move is effective, it is not efficient. In this paper, we introduce the notion of agent compromise into ERA and evaluate its effectiveness and efficiency through solving some benchmark Graph Coloring Problems (GCPs). When solving a GCP by ERA, the edges are transformed into two types of constraints: local constraints and neighbor constraints. When the system gets stuck in a local minimum, a compromise of two neighboring agents that have common violated neighbor constraints may be made. The compromise can eliminate the original violated neighbor constraints and make the two agents act as a single agent. Our experimental results show that agent compromise is an effective and efficient technique for guiding a multi-agent system to escape from a local minimum.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Adaptive Compromises in Distributed Problem Solving

ABSTRACT The ERA method is a multi-agent oriented method for solving onstraint satisfa tion problems. During problem solving, distributed agents in ERAmake de isions based on their own lo al environments. Although ea h agent has multiple lo al variables and the rea tive behaviors of the agent are lo al, the system an rea h a solution state. In this paper, we introdu e agent ompromises in solvin...

متن کامل

On Modeling Multiagent Task Scheduling as a Distributed Constraint Optimization Problem

This paper investigates how to represent and solve multiagent task scheduling as a Distributed Constraint Optimization Problem (DCOP). Recently multiagent researchers have adopted the C TÆMS language as a standard for multiagent task scheduling. We contribute an automated mapping that transforms C TÆMS into a DCOP. Further, we propose a set of representational compromises for C TÆMS that allow ...

متن کامل

A Testbed For the Evaluation of Multi-Agent Communication and Problem-Solving Strategies

We present here a distributed problem-solving testbed, which we use for experimental analysis of the relationships among distributed problem structure, inter-agent communication and coordination strategies, and problem-solving performance. Distributed problems in our system are represented as distributed CSPs. The testbed consists of two parameterized components: (1) a problem generator, for th...

متن کامل

A Distributed Problem-Solving Approach to Rule Induction: Learning in Distributed Artificial Intelligence Systems

One of the interesting characteristics of multi-agent problem solving in distributed artificial intelligence(DAI) systems is that the agents are able to learn from each other, thereby facilitating the problem-solving process and enhancing the quality of the solution generated. This paper aims at studying the multi-agent learning mechanism involved in a specific group learning situation: the ind...

متن کامل

Designing Responsive and Deliberative Automated Negotiators

In this paper we present a multi issue negotiation model which can be used for guiding agents during distributed problem solving This model is composed of proto cols which govern and manage agent interactions and an agent architecture which represents decision mech anisms which assist agents during distributed problem solving processes keywords Negotiation Agent Architecture

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2003